Energy Engineer/ Project Developer This position can be remote, Upstate NY. Our Client is a leading provider of Mechanical Design/ Build and ENERGY solutions in the up-state NY region. They are one of the top companies in the area.Overview This professional will be responsible for identifying project opportunities by conducting feasibility assessments in one or more market verticals (MUSH Market). They will also perform preliminary and detailed facility audits to identify and develop improvement measure project opportunities.Responsibilities Coordinate and lead facility site visits with client representative and communicate with outside vendors as it pertains to FIM developmentLead technical aspects of preliminary and final performance contracting proposal development, including energy benchmarks, proposed project descriptions, utility cost savings and preliminary cost estimatesDetermine existing facility AMEP system design and control concepts and operating characteristics with client technical representativeDetermine original systems design concepts and control strategies; compare with existing system operating characteristicsBenchmark facilities utility use and costs compared to applicable standards (CBECS, etc.)Reconcile utility use of applicable AMEP systems by applying operating characteristics or using energy simulation softwareCompare existing building system operating efficiencies to current energy efficiency/code standards and industry best practices. Determine and rank potential opportunities to renovate systems to improve system efficiencies and reduce operating costsDetermine potential savings and overall project opportunityCalculate energy and cost savings using existing templates or create new calculations using applicable software toolsCreate detailed project scopes of work. Coordinate project scope contact with Operations in order to meet bidding requirementsDetermine savings interaction from proposed FIMS and expected rate changesCoordinate project development opportunities with Operations representativeWork in a team environment that includes managers, sales, estimating, design/CAD, construction & service personnel to drive businessExperience and Requirements BSME or EE or related discipline is highly desirable and advanced degree is a plus with equivalent work and field experience.
